Output 734c350ac664bfd9618820a4a9abf2a4366d29921c3402416e36769431a7e84b:0

value
2559237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d191c59775ed3edbf6ccf24faee9928a116a8592 OP_EQUAL
address
3Lo7n3Mo9v7FNJmQpK2DVE8n1ibz2yabX8
transaction
734c350ac664bfd9618820a4a9abf2a4366d29921c3402416e36769431a7e84b
confirmations
86510
spent
true